Renegade Hearts by Nikki J Summers


RENEGADE HEARTS is Book 1 in the REBELS OF SANDLAND series by Nikki J Summers. It is a New Adult standalone. (But you really want to read the entire series in sequence to be sure to get the most out of it and TOTALLY RECOMMEND the audiobooks, narrated by Shane East and Faye Adele!)


I absolutely loved this book! Let me tell you the background to this. I read The Psycho. I got it on audio. I fell in love with the characters all over again. I was dying for the next audio to come out and the day it got released, I got it. Same narrators, same author, and I am not disappointed. It's absolutely brilliant!

And even though I am more akin in age to the parents in this story and have three children of my own in that generation, I could really relate to the characters from my own life experience and I found Emily and Ryan both wonderful. Their friends make great additions to the plot and the parents, well, I loved to hate Emily's and loved Ryan's dad. Such a lovely man!

The story itself has all the elements of a great love story and doesn't go short on surprising twists, either. It's a slowburn but considering what happens and that Emily doesn't have any experience as yet, it is definitely the best way to write this and perfectly fitting. I wouldn't have liked it any other way for those two. Still, the book doesn't lack longing and passion that are all too palpable and once the two young adults get going, the steam is there full-on. Absolutely well-deserved five stars! Can't wait for the next one!

Nikki J Summers


Nikki J Summers is a British author who was born and raised in Birmingham, the home of the Peaky Blinders. She currently lives in Staffordshire with her husband, two children, a cavapoo called Poppy, and two guinea pigs, Cookie and Blaize. She writes U.K. based new adult and dark romance stories about morally grey heroes who would burn the world to save their heroine. Those heroines usually save themselves, but the heroes are always by their side holding the matches. Much like her soldiers, she wears many masks; schoolteacher, romance writer, wife, mother, daughter, sister... the list is endless, but she loves wearing every single one of them.
